Summary

A picture book illustrated with stills from the animated television series, Titch. Titch has no one to play with - everyone's busy - but then Mum suggests that she and Titch have a picnic and a game of football in the park. Then it starts to rain. Where can they have their picnic now?

About Pat Hutchins

Pat Hutchins has always loved drawing and at the age of 16 won a scholarship to Darlington Art School. She is now one of the most popular picture book creators in the world with over 30 children's books published after the success of her classic Rosie's Walk.
